10Michelangelo’s Dome
The iconic dome of St. Peter’s Basilica is a masterpiece designed by the Renaissance genius Michelangelo.
Completed in 1590, the dome is an engineering marvel, soaring 136 meters into the sky. What many might not know is that Michelangelo’s original design underwent modifications after his death, with Giacomo della Porta and Domenico Fontana overseeing the final construction. The dome’s breathtaking beauty and structural prowess are a testament to the collaborative efforts of these renowned artists.
